Cost and Funding

Analysis

The State of Alaska appropriated $10 million in 2008 and another $17.5 million in 2009 to support the Surface Transportation Board (STB) process for considering the request for a license to construct and operate the rail line. The STB process includes alternative analysis, preliminary engineering, National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) environmental documentation, and a financial feasibility study.

Design & Construction

The final design and construction of a rail extension to Port MacKenzie is estimated to cost $300 million (2007 dollars). The Matanuska-Susitna Borough and the Alaska Railroad will jointly conduct a financing study to assess options for funding the project.
